Conway Man Seeks $1 Million from Police After Violent Shooting Incident

In a dramatic turn of events, Tywrell Alston has taken a bold step in the aftermath of a December 2022 officer-involved shooting that left him severely injured. Alston, currently incarcerated at the J. Reuben Long Detention Center, has filed a handwritten complaint in the Horry County Common Pleas Court seeking a hefty $1 million from the Conway Police Department.

The Incident That Sparked Controversy

On December 29, 2022, a seemingly routine traffic stop on Forest Loop Road spiraled into chaos. Alston, who was reportedly being followed by another vehicle, claims this pursuit left him terrified for his safety. Amid the tension, he allegedly opened fire at Detective Nicholas Contino after pulling into a driveway.

As the situation escalated, Det. Contino responded by firing back, hitting Alston a staggering 10 times, ultimately leading to life-threatening injuries. The gravity of the incident raised several questions regarding police conduct and the circumstances that prompted such a violent exchange.

Ongoing Legal Battles

Despite the severe injuries he sustained, which include a broken jaw, the loss of his left kidney, and part of his colon, Alston finds himself facing multiple criminal charges, including attempted murder and possession of a firearm during a violent crime. His bond has been denied on three separate occasions, keeping him locked up as he navigates this complex legal situation. Alston is also charged with offenses related to firearms and misuse, such as pointing and presenting firearms at a person and discharging firearms into a dwelling.

Seeking Dismissal of Charges

As part of his lawsuit, Alston is not only seeking monetary damages but also requesting the dismissal of the charges against him. He alleges that he was shot while on the ground and asserts that the officer did not issue commands to stop or freeze, raising questions about the escalation of force used. Alston contends these factors contributed significantly to the dangerous encounter that day.

Health Complications and Legal Claims

Adding another layer to the case, Alston claims that he has been suffering from Post Traumatic Stress Disorder (PTSD) as a direct result of the shooting. He argues that he has not received the appropriate medical care since the incident and still carries bullet fragments in his body, illustrating the ongoing impact this traumatic event has had on his life.

An investigation conducted by the 15th Circuit Solicitor’s Office concluded that Det. Contino would not face charges in relation to the incident, a decision that might intensify Alston’s legal claims against the police department.
